Vroeger...
, toen was er een telefoongids, die je omkeerbaar kunt doorzoeken, met een progje genaamd foongrep.. Toen kwam de grote boze KPN, en die veranderde elke keer het formaat van de data-bestanden op de CDFoonGids. Maar onze foongrep wist dat iedere keer weer te kraken. KPN besloot toen een boze brief te sturen, en foongrepje hield netjes op te bestaan.
Tot op heden ken ik geen alternatief, behalve de (verouderde) Phone_BOT
Tot op heden ken ik geen alternatief, behalve de (verouderde) Phone_BOT
|_____vakje______|
Verwijderd
De icq protocollen zijn redelijk gedocumenteerd, cdfoon is met foonrip vrij handig uit te lezen (ook de nieuwe) en in een databaseje te proppen, ff stukje code maken die die troep aan elkaar lijmt... *klaar*?
ik vermoed licq (oid) icm. een scriptingding en foongrep oid
Klaar voor een nieuwe uitdaging.
Ik weet wel zeker dat het met licq gedaan is
(Als ik met licq bij 'm kijk, staat er dat het een licq client is)...
Voordeel van licq is dat je je binnenkomende berichten kunt doorsturen naar een programmatje. Verder kun je door text in het licq_fifo bestandje te schrijven ook allemaal commando's uitvoeren.
Veel progwerk komt er dus niet aan te pas
Voordeel van licq is dat je je binnenkomende berichten kunt doorsturen naar een programmatje. Verder kun je door text in het licq_fifo bestandje te schrijven ook allemaal commando's uitvoeren.
Veel progwerk komt er dus niet aan te pas
Ken Thompson's famous line from V6 UNIX is equaly applicable to this post:
'You are not expected to understand this'
na de maak-een-cool-icon rage wordt het tijd voor een maak-een-cool-icqding rage!Op donderdag 30 augustus 2001 11:30 schreef Janoz het volgende:
Ik weet wel zeker dat het met licq gedaan is(Als ik met licq bij 'm kijk, staat er dat het een licq client is)...
Voordeel van licq is dat je je binnenkomende berichten kunt doorsturen naar een programmatje. Verder kun je door text in het licq_fifo bestandje te schrijven ook allemaal commando's uitvoeren.
Veel progwerk komt er dus niet aan te pas
Klaar voor een nieuwe uitdaging.
ik ben nu bezig met een icq bot, verrassend makkelijk!
ik maak hem even af, test hem en zal dan een kleine tut posten hier (linux-only)
ik maak hem even af, test hem en zal dan een kleine tut posten hier (linux-only)
Klaar voor een nieuwe uitdaging.
Wat voor 'n ding wordt het chem? Wat gaat ie doen?!
|_____vakje______|
Euh, let's not!Op donderdag 30 augustus 2001 11:32 schreef chem het volgende:
[..]
na de maak-een-cool-icon rage wordt het tijd voor een maak-een-cool-icqding rage!
nou als begin wordt dit een bot waar je een adres of postcode geeft en je de gegevens terugkrijgt die erbij horenOp donderdag 30 augustus 2001 19:47 schreef CyberSnooP het volgende:
Wat voor 'n ding wordt het chem? Wat gaat ie doen?!
hier een kleine tip van de sluier:
configure/make/install licq;
configure/make/install licq/plug-ins/console
configure/make/install licq/plug-ins/auto-reply
pico .licq/licq_autorepl.conf => /usr/bin/perl /home/ikke/form.pl
en dat was het wel... alles draait nu (pokke perl hehehe ) maar het postcodescript wil niet meewerken...
Klaar voor een nieuwe uitdaging.
zeurpietOp donderdag 30 augustus 2001 20:15 schreef Hans het volgende:
[..]
Euh, let's not!
maar hij draait! je kan al postcodes opgeven en je krijgt netjes antwoord. alleen is de 'input' nog een beetje abstract dus daar moet ik aan de parelzijde wat aan klussen...
Klaar voor een nieuwe uitdaging.
<h2>ICQ bot tutorial</h2>
installeer licq
download licq van http://www.licq.com/
geef een "tar xzvf licq-1.0.3.tar.gz"
dan 'cd licq-1.0.3/;
doe ./configure, make, make install
je hebt nu licq geinstalleerd maar je kan er weinig mee. Je hebt nog een interface nodig. Zelf koos ik voor de meegeleverde console versie.
installeer console plugin
cd 'plugins/console/'
weer: ./configure, make, make install
als het goed is staat er in /usr/local/lib/licq/ nu 2 files; licq_console.so en .la
je kan nu licq opstarten maar we gaan een bot maken; we moeten de auto-reply plugin installeren:
installeer auto-reply plugin
cd '../auto-reply/'
weer: ./configure, make, make install
weer 2 files extra in /usr/local/lib/licq/
registreer een UIN voor je bot
doe dit via je 'echte' icq want ik had problemen met halve registraties etc.
start licq
geef 'licq -p console' en licq start op met de console-plugin.
kies voor een reeds bestaand account, geef de data en je bent klaar.
met /help kan je evt. help krijgen. Je kan ook meteen /exit geven.
Of speel even met /message en /view !
instellen auto-reply plugin
je moet de licq_autoreply.conf file verplaatsen naar je .licq/ map. Vaak staat die in /home/user/ .
De licq_autoreply.conf file vind je in licq-1.0.3/plugins/auto-reply/
Hierna kun je die file editten; de 'cat' optie zoals aangegeven in die file is een mooie test.
start licq met auto-reply
start licq nu zo op: 'licq -f -o /home/user/licq.out -p autoreply -- -e -l online' waarbij user je eigen naam is.
Die levert je een licq op de achtergrond op, alle output gaat naar licq.out en de auto-reply plugin start op met status:online
test je auto-reply
Stuur een bericht. Als ales klopt krijg je nu een bericht terug! (mits je de cat-instellingen hebt uitgevoerd)
verder gaan
Zelf heb ik als Program in de conf-file '/usr/bin/perl /home/michiel/form.pl' ingevuld die met de STDIN aan de slag gaat. Wijzig dit zoals je het nodig hebt.
succes!!!
installeer licq
download licq van http://www.licq.com/
geef een "tar xzvf licq-1.0.3.tar.gz"
dan 'cd licq-1.0.3/;
doe ./configure, make, make install
je hebt nu licq geinstalleerd maar je kan er weinig mee. Je hebt nog een interface nodig. Zelf koos ik voor de meegeleverde console versie.
installeer console plugin
cd 'plugins/console/'
weer: ./configure, make, make install
als het goed is staat er in /usr/local/lib/licq/ nu 2 files; licq_console.so en .la
je kan nu licq opstarten maar we gaan een bot maken; we moeten de auto-reply plugin installeren:
installeer auto-reply plugin
cd '../auto-reply/'
weer: ./configure, make, make install
weer 2 files extra in /usr/local/lib/licq/
registreer een UIN voor je bot
doe dit via je 'echte' icq want ik had problemen met halve registraties etc.
start licq
geef 'licq -p console' en licq start op met de console-plugin.
kies voor een reeds bestaand account, geef de data en je bent klaar.
met /help kan je evt. help krijgen. Je kan ook meteen /exit geven.
Of speel even met /message en /view !
instellen auto-reply plugin
je moet de licq_autoreply.conf file verplaatsen naar je .licq/ map. Vaak staat die in /home/user/ .
De licq_autoreply.conf file vind je in licq-1.0.3/plugins/auto-reply/
Hierna kun je die file editten; de 'cat' optie zoals aangegeven in die file is een mooie test.
start licq met auto-reply
start licq nu zo op: 'licq -f -o /home/user/licq.out -p autoreply -- -e -l online' waarbij user je eigen naam is.
Die levert je een licq op de achtergrond op, alle output gaat naar licq.out en de auto-reply plugin start op met status:online
test je auto-reply
Stuur een bericht. Als ales klopt krijg je nu een bericht terug! (mits je de cat-instellingen hebt uitgevoerd)
verder gaan
Zelf heb ik als Program in de conf-file '/usr/bin/perl /home/michiel/form.pl' ingevuld die met de STDIN aan de slag gaat. Wijzig dit zoals je het nodig hebt.
succes!!!
Klaar voor een nieuwe uitdaging.
[lichtelijk offtopic]
licq ruleert sowieso
Kun je allemaal vars in je n/a message zetten (Zoals nick of naam van degene die het opvraagt. Kreeg ik bijna ruzie met mijn vriendin omdat ze 'Nee ingrid, ik ben nu ff bezig' als N/A message kreeg
[/lichtelijk offtopic]
licq ruleert sowieso
Kun je allemaal vars in je n/a message zetten (Zoals nick of naam van degene die het opvraagt. Kreeg ik bijna ruzie met mijn vriendin omdat ze 'Nee ingrid, ik ben nu ff bezig' als N/A message kreeg
[/lichtelijk offtopic]
Ken Thompson's famous line from V6 UNIX is equaly applicable to this post:
'You are not expected to understand this'
Pagina: 1